DIN 1629 seamless steel pipe its main grades are St37.0, St44.0, St52.0, DIN 1629. Generally, the DIN 1629 standard is not limited to the working pressure value, and the working temperature is limited to below 300 ℃.
Product Parameters
Product Name DIN 1629 Seamless Steel Pipe Standard EN/DIN/JIS/ASTM/BS/ASME/AISI etc. Outer Diameter Seamless: 1/4"-36" Welding: 21.3mm-3620mm Round Tube: 1/2"-10" Square Tube/Rectangular Tube: 15x15mm-400x600mm Wall Thickness Seamless: 1.25mm-50mm Welding: 1.65mm-65mm Length 3-12 meters, Support customization Surface Process Bright, Polished, Black Other Services Machining(cnc), Centerless Grinding(cg), Heat Treatment, Annealing, Pickling, Polishing, Rolling, Forging, Cutting, Bending, Small Machining, etc.
Chemical Composition
Grade Materials No. Deoxidation Yype C P S N¹) St37 1.0254 R 0.17 0.040 0.040 0.009 ²) St44 1.0255 R 0.21 0.040 0.040 0.009 ²) St52 1.0421 RR 0.22 0.040 0.035 -
Mechanical Properties
DIN 1629 Yield Strength(Wall Thickness/mm) Tensile Strength N/² mm Elongation(%) A5 Grade Material No. <16 16-40 40-65 Vertical Transverse St37 1.0254 235 225 216 350²) to 480 25 23 St44 1.0256 275 265 ¹) 255 ¹) 420²) to 550 21 19 St52 1.0421 355 345 335 500²) to 650 21 19
Scope of Application
Seamless steel pipe applications are: chemical plants, vessels, pipeline engineering and general mechanical engineering.
